About
The study aims to explore the origins of proteins, which became crucial cellular machinery on early Earth. The emergence of living systems from a non-living prebiotic soup remains a mystery. Modern protein synthesis relies on a complex ribosome, and it is unlikely that anything similar existed on Earth 3-4 billion years ago. The building blocks of life, such as amino acids and nucleobase, were likely present on prebiotic Earth. Self-assembled nano-fibers of peptide/amino acid-nucleobase conjugate molecules will be tested as a template for prebiotic protein synthesis. The selected peptides/proteins will be studied inside vesicles to investigate prebiotic catalysis and its impact on protocellular survivability.
